Sacred Rhetoric: Dietrich Bonhoeffer and the Participatory Tradition

Justin Mandela Roberts
4.9/5 (25491 ratings)
Description:Dietrich Bonhoeffer is a celebrated and enigmatic figure in theology. Though he is known for advocating a concrete and worldly Christianity, Justin Mandela Roberts argues that his theology is in continuity with a participatory ontology, especially as seen in the ressourcement movement and Radical Orthodoxy. While critical of such "metaphysical speculation," Bonhoeffer displays similar inclinations that situate Truth, Goodness, and Beauty as transcendental aspects of divine being. His theology affirms the pervasive "rhetoric" of doxology, details the economy of reciprocal gift-giving, and celebrates the sacramentality of creation.
